You can view more details on each measurement unit: gallon [US, dry] or yards The SI derived unit for volume is the cubic meter. 1 cubic meter is equal to 227.02074456538 gallon [US, dry], or 1.307950613786 … WebTo calculate compost volumes you’ll need a rough idea of the size of the area you want to cover, and the depth of compost you need to apply. The amount of compost required is the product of three things multiplied together: the width, the length and the depth.
